Ridiculously Easy Cinnamon Rolls

These no-yeast, no-rise, make-ahead, Ridiculously Easy Cinnamon Rolls employ a secret technique that makes them melt-in-your-mouth delicious!
Course Breakfast
Cuisine American
Prep Time 40 minutes
Cook Time 18 minutes
Total Time 58 minutes
Servings 8 Servings
Calories 380 kcal
Author Chris Scheuer

Ingredients

  • For the rolls:
  • 1 cup cold buttermilk
  • 4 ounces butter
  • 2 cups all-purpose flour more for counter
  • 2 tablespoon sugar
  • ½ teaspoon baking soda
  • 2 teaspoons baking powder
  • ½ teaspoon kosher salt
  • ¼ cup sugar
  • 1 teaspoon  cinnamon
  • ½ cup raisins or currents
  • For the icing:
  • 1 ¼ cups powdered sugar
  • 3 tablespoons milk or half and half
  • ½ teaspoon vanilla extract

Instructions

  1. 1. Adjust oven rack to middle position and heat oven to 425°F. Line a sheet pan with parchment paper or spray a sheet pan with cooking spray.
  2. 2. In a medium size bowl or cup, measure 1 cup of buttermilk and place in the freezer while prepping other ingredients (you want it to be in the freezer about 10 minutes.
  3. 3. Place butter in a microwave safe bowl, cover with a paper towel and heat on high for 1 minute. If not completely melted, return to microwave for 10 second intervals till melted. Set aside to cool a bit while prepping other ingredients.
  4. 4. Whisk flour, baking powder, baking soda, sugar and salt in large bowl.
  5. 5. Remove buttermilk from the freezer and add the melted butter. Stir with a fork until butter forms small clumps or globules. (See picture in post.)
  6. 6. Add buttermilk mixture to dry ingredients and stir with a sturdy spatula, just until all flour is incorporated and batter pulls away from sides of bowl.
  7. 7. Generously flour a work surface. Dump dough onto prepared work surface and turn to coat all surfaces with flour. Knead on counter 15-20 times (about 30 seconds) until dough forms a smooth ball. Add a little more flour to the work surface. Flip dough twice to coat with flour.
  8. 8. With a floured rolling pin, roll the dough out into a rectangle, approximately 12 x 8 inches, with long side facing you. Combine sugar and cinnamon. Sprinkle dough with sugar mixture and raisins (or currents).
  9. 9. Starting with the long end facing you, roll up dough and pinch edge together to seal. Cut into 8 1 ½-inch slices. Reshape slices into a circular shape (if they’ve become flattened while cutting) and place on prepared pan, spacing about 2 inches apart.
  10. 10. Place in oven and bake until tops are golden, about 15 to 18 minutes.
  11. 11. While the rolls are baking, make the icing by whisking together the powdered sugar, half and half and vanilla until smooth and creamy.
  12. 12. Drizzle icing over cinnamon rolls while they are still warm.
